Frequently Asked Questions about Studio El Cerrito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in El Cerrito with Studio?

Currently the most affordable Studio in El Cerrito is at Bosco listed at $1,090.

How much is the average rent for a Studio El Cerrito Apartment?

The average rent for a Studio Apartment in El Cerrito is $2,183.

What is the largest available Studio El Cerrito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in El Cerrito is a 750 square feet unit starting from $1,495 at 1176 University.

What is the average size for El Cerrito Studio Apartments for rent?

The average size for a Studio rental in El Cerrito is currently 380 sq ft.
